Argument name specifies the keymap name. This is an optional argument.
However this code:
from xkeysnail.transform import Key, define_keymap
define_keymap(None, {
Key.CAPSLOCK: Key.LEFT_META,
Key.LEFT_META: Key.ESC,
Key.ESC : Key.CAPSLOCK,
}, None) # <-- Name is None here
Results in this error:
File "/usr/local/lib/python3.10/dist-packages/xkeysnail/transform.py", line 457, in transform_key
print("WM_CLASS '{}' | active keymaps = [{}]".format(wm_class, ", ".join(keymap_names)))
TypeError: sequence item 0: expected str instance, NoneType found
However adding a name makes it work fine:
from xkeysnail.transform import Key, define_keymap
define_keymap(None, {
Key.CAPSLOCK: Key.LEFT_META,
Key.LEFT_META: Key.ESC,
Key.ESC : Key.CAPSLOCK,
}, "Michael") # <-- Name is set here
